The daughter of a San Antonio inventor killed by a falling jet engine at Port San Antonio last year has sued an aerospace company that had retrofitted equipment involved in the accident. David Monroe, founder and director of the San Antonio Museum of Science and Technology, died last September when a 5,000-pound jet engine that he and a colleague were moving rolled onto him at a loading dock at the Boeing Center at Tech Port. The engine was to be an exhibit at the museum’s Area 21 facility…
